RE: 4wheeler question/problem
I am thinking tha perhaps your needle valves or seats are worn out or gummed upfrom trying to run it with all that water in it.. I am not sure but it could be getting to much gas in it causing the slow down. Have you noticed any more gas being burnt out of it for the same miles you normally run? If so I would be getting that checked into.. Good luck with it..